STORYBOOK SONGS
(60 mins)


As seen at WNED-TV Kid Fest and the Children's Summer Theatre at Eastern Hills Mall, Matt encourages reading through the power of music. Classic and modern storybook characters are the inspiration for the songs in this program, a great addition to your library event schedule or for school reading/book appreciation programs. Children learn about the positive traits these characters possess, and how to develop these traits in themselves.

SONGWRITING IS FUN!
(60 mins)

Children and teens explore composition and creative writing by learning the basics of combining words and music to write a song. This imaginative program is a great exercise for brainstorming and team building. 

"Songwriting is Fun" can be presented as a large assembly program, but is better suited for smaller groups (classroom size). It is a great supplement for music or creative writing classes and clubs

SCHOOL OF ROCK
(60 mins)


A history of popular music from 1955 onward is presented along with a demonstration of the technologies by which it was delivered. The audience joins in the action by learning dance fads from each decade.

This program can be presented for any size group and is perfect for large assemblies.
